Swelling, or edema, is the accumulation of fluid in the tissues, causing an increase in size or volume of the affected area. This condition can occur locally in specific regions, such as the ankles or hands, or systemically throughout the body. Swelling is a common response to a variety of underlying issues and can result from numerous causes. Common causes of swelling include injury or trauma, where the body's inflammatory response leads to fluid buildup around the damaged area. Infections can also cause localized swelling, often accompanied by redness, warmth, and pain. Inflammatory conditions, such as arthritis or autoimmune diseases, contribute to swelling through chronic inflammation of tissues or joints. Circulatory issues, including chronic venous insufficiency or deep vein thrombosis, can impair blood flow and lead to fluid accumulation in the extremities. Fluid retention due to conditions like congestive heart failure, kidney disease, or liver disease can cause generalized swelling as the body struggles to manage fluid balance. Allergic reactions to substances such as foods, medications, or insect stings may result in localized swelling and associated symptoms like itching. Certain medications, particularly those affecting blood pressure or containing corticosteroids, can also lead to swelling as a side effect.
Treatment for swelling is directed at addressing the underlying cause. For swelling due to injury, methods like rest, elevation, and ice application can help reduce inflammation and fluid accumulation. In cases of infection, appropriate antibiotics or antiviral medications are used. Chronic conditions such as heart failure or kidney disease require management of the primary disease, which may involve medications, lifestyle changes, and dietary modifications. Allergic reactions are treated with antihistamines or corticosteroids to alleviate symptoms. If swelling is persistent, severe, or accompanied by significant symptoms like pain, shortness of breath, or fever, a medical evaluation is crucial to diagnose the cause and guide appropriate treatment.
